With regard to insurance cover, owners are advised that the sections are covered for all standard finishings. Should an owner upgrade his/her unit or erect an approved improvement, an owner may declare non-standard improvements to the insurer to take note of the installation and have the installation form part of the building insurance policy, should they wish to do so. Non-standard improvements are improvements / alterations that increase the value of your unit after the unit was built and does not include the standard fixtures and fitting from development. If non-standard improvements are not endorsed, it is not insured.

Non-standard installations may include marble tops, solar installations, air conditioning units, laminated wooden flooring, wendy houses, garage door motors, alarm systems, gas installations, etc. Please ensure that all non-standard improvements are declared in order to request the insurer to cover this under the body corporate policy. Please note that if non-standard improvements are not declared it is not insured.

Please take note of the below standard conditions when installing a non-standard improvement:

  • Registered and reputable service providers & contractors should be used.
  • All COC’s where applicable, need to be provided to the Managing Agent and Insurer, where applicable. This will apply to solar installations, gas installations, amongst others.
  • The Body Corporate will accept no liability or responsibility for any instance directly or indirectly related to the installation and as such, no claim may be instituted against the Body Corporate’s insurance policy, unless the installation has been specified and covered in terms of the building insurance policy.
  • Should an additional premium apply for the installation, your levy account will be debited accordingly and same is payable together with your monthly levy contributions.
  • The Trustees reserve the right to inspect any installation to ensure all is in order. Sufficient notice will be given in this regard where required. Should the installation not adhere to the specifications and conditions as set out, the Trustees reserve the right to instruct for the installation to be removed and the area of installation to be returned to its original state, at the cost of the concerned owner.
